RocksIgneous rocks –

• Formed by the cooling and crystallization of hot molten rock called magma

• Igneous means – formed by fire

• 95% of the earth crust are igneous rocks

• examples include basalt and granite

Rocks

Sedimentary rocks – • Formed by weatherd

material carried by water, wind or ice.• Most common rock in the upper part

of the earth’s crust• They cover 2/3 of earths surface.• Examples include sandstone, shale

and limestone

Rocks

Metamorphic rocks –

• Formed from pre-existing rocks that are transformed under high

• temperature and pressure.

• Metamorphic means – changed in form

• Examples include marble, slate and diamond

Minerals

• Minerals – The building blocks of rocks.

• Minerals are naturally formed, generally inorganic crystalline solid composed of an ordered array of atoms having a specific composition.

• Minerals differ from one another in their combination and proportion of elements and internal arrangement of atoms.

Classifying MineralsMohs Hardness Scale

Hardness is measured on the Mohs Scale, identified numerically hardness of by standard minerals, from 1 (softest) to 10 (hardest):

1. Talc 2. Gypsum 3. Clacite 4. Fluorite 5. Apatite 6. Orthoclase 7. Quartz 8. Topaz 9. Corundum 10.Diamond

• A mineral of a given hardenss will scratch a mineral of a lower number. With a systematic approach, you can use minerals of known hardness to determine the relative hardness of any other mineral.

Classifying Minerals

• Cleavage – tendency of a mineral to break along planes of weakness.

• Fracture – break that is not along the lines of a cleavage plane

Classifying Minerals

• Luster – appearance of its surface as it reflects light

• Luster is independent of color

Classifying Luster of Minerals• Adamantine - very gemmy crystals • Dull - just a non-reflective surface of any kind • Earthy - the look of dirt or dried mud • Fibrous - the look of fibers • Greasy - the look of grease • Gumdrop - the look a sucked on hard candy • Metallic - the look of metals • Pearly - the look of a pearl • Pitchy - the look of tar • Resinous - the look of resins such as dried glue or chewing

gum • Silky - the look of silk, similar to fibrous but more compact • Submetallic - a poor metallic luster, opaque but reflecting little

light • Vitreous - the most common luster, it simply means the look of

glass • Waxy - the look of wax

Classifying Minerals

• Color – is usually a poor way to judge minerals – the same mineral may exhibit a variety of colors

• Streak – color or mineral in its powder form. Usually obtained by rubbing across a porcelain plate.

Oxides and Carbonates

• Oxides – metals combined with oxygen

Iron (hematite-magnetite) chromium (chromitite) manganese (pyrolusite) tin (cassiterite) uraninum (uraninite)

• Most metals come from these ores

Oxides and Carbonates

• Carbonates – minerals composed of carbonate ion CO3

Calcite – calcium carbonate CaCO3

Dolomite – calcium and magnesium carbonate CaMg(CO3)2

These two make up limestone calcite From yahoo images
